Modern Expansion: Major upgrades and Terminal 3 completed in 2010

Indira Gandhi International Airport (IGIA), initially established in the 1930s, underwent a transformative phase in the early 21st century to meet the demands of India’s rapidly growing air traffic. The centerpiece of this modernization was the completion of Terminal 3 in 2010, a project that redefined the airport’s capacity, efficiency, and passenger experience. This expansion was not merely about adding space; it was a strategic overhaul to position IGIA as a global aviation hub.

The construction of Terminal 3 was a monumental undertaking, spanning 5.4 million square feet and designed to handle 34 million passengers annually. Its architecture, blending contemporary aesthetics with functional efficiency, set a new benchmark for airport design in India. The terminal introduced advanced features such as inline baggage screening, automated check-in kiosks, and a multi-level parking facility, streamlining operations and reducing passenger wait times. The integration of these technologies was a leap forward, addressing long-standing challenges like congestion and delays.

Beyond infrastructure, Terminal 3 prioritized passenger comfort and convenience. Its expansive retail and dining areas, featuring both international brands and local offerings, transformed the airport into a lifestyle destination. The inclusion of lounges, prayer rooms, and rest zones catered to diverse traveler needs, ensuring a seamless and enjoyable journey. The terminal’s sustainability initiatives, such as rainwater harvesting and energy-efficient systems, underscored a commitment to environmental responsibility, aligning with global aviation trends.

The impact of Terminal 3 extended beyond IGIA, influencing the broader aviation landscape in India. It served as a model for other airports undergoing modernization, emphasizing the importance of scalability, technology, and passenger-centric design. The terminal’s success also bolstered Delhi’s status as a key transit hub, enhancing connectivity between Southeast Asia, Europe, and the Middle East. This expansion was not just about physical growth but about elevating India’s aviation standards to compete on the global stage.
